Julio César de León Dailey (born September 13, 1979 in Puerto Cortés ) is a Honduran football player , he plays on the position of midfielder .
Career
Julío Cesar Dailey Leon started his career in Europe in 2001 with the Italian club Reggina Calcio , where he became a regular in his first season. At the end of his first season Reggina took a promotion place and rose surprisingly in the Serie A on. In the following two seasons, Reggina was able to hold on to Leon in Serie A. In Serie A, Leon lost his starting place and the 2003-04 season he moved to the traditional club Fiorentina in the Serie B . Since he was hardly used here, León moved to the Serie C1 club SS Sambenedettese Calcio at the end of the season . Here he stayed again for only one season before moving to the Serie B club US Catanzaro . For the 2005/06 season, the Honduran moved to Teramo Calcio . But Leon returned to Serie B during the winter break and played for US Avellino until the end of the season . For the 2006/07 season Leon returned to Reggina Calcio, his first stop in Italy, before he moved to CFC Genoa the following season . Leon has been playing for FC Parma since the 2008/09 season .
